Description
We are a family of three members; father, mother and myself. We are interested to host volunteers who can help us with our household work in our village with us.

Cultural exchange and learning opportunities
Volunteers will benefit from cultural exchange; we can help you show around our village and interact with the villagers which will help volunteers to familiarize with our lifestyle in more detail. It will be great experience in sharing our language knowledge with each others.
Help
We are a family of three members living in the southern part of Pokhara. Currently, we are looking for volunteers who can help us looking after our farmhouse and some cattle. We will need help in some general maintenance around the house, building fence and gardening. We will greatly appreciate those volunteers who could engage in Nepali and English language practice with us. We will be happy to share Nepali meal twice a day with the volunteers.

Accommodation
Typical Nepali House made of stone, mud, wood and metallic roof. A separate room will be provided without attach bathroom and without hot water.
What else ...
We have a great view of range of mountains from our farmhouse. Volunteers can also walk to the famous lake of Pokhara, Fewa lake which is in 25 minutes walking distance from our farmhouse. Volunteers can experience walking on hanging (suspension) bridge to reach our home. There is a famous river called Fusrekhola near our farmhouse.
